Koofteh Tabrizi is a super meatball stuffed with dried fruits and berries, also a variety of nuts. There are some other interesting fillings for this very traditional Azeri dish that are worth mentioning. One very common item is a peeled hard boiled egg that is placed inside the koofteh along with nuts and dried fruit. The ingredients needed to make Persian meatball (Kofteh Tabrizi):
  1. Take 400 g ground meat (half beef/ half lamb)
  2. Make ready 2 onions
  3. Prepare 200 g yellow split peas, cooked
  4. Get 70 g rice, cooked
  5. Make ready 50 g mixed fresh herbs: chives, mint, tarragon, parsley, coriander and savory or marzeh. Finely chopped
  6. Make ready 5-6 baby potatoes
  7. Take to taste Salt and pepper
  8. Get Ingredients for filling
  9. Make ready 1 cooked and peeled egg for each meat ball
  10. Make ready 1 prune for each meat ball
  11. Take 1/2 tsp barberries for each meat ball
  12. Make ready Some crushed walnuts
  13. Prepare 1 large onion, chopped and fried
  14. Prepare Ingredients for sauce
  15. Get 4 tbsp. tomato paste
  16. Take 1 large onion, finely chopped
  17. Take 1/2 tsp turmeric
  18. Get to taste Salt and pepper
  19. Get Oil

Instructions to make Persian meatball (Kofteh Tabrizi):
  1. First prepare the sauce: heat the oil in a saucepan, add chopped onion and satue for 5 minutes.
  2. Add pinch of salt / pepper, turmeric
  3. And tomato paste.
  4. Stir for another 5 minutes. Set aside.
  5. Mix minced meat (beef and lamb) and ground 2-3 times by a meat grinder until paste like.Grind precooked rice and yellow split peas. Grate onions, squeeze out the juice. In a bowl with the meat mixture, add onion, rice, yellow split peas and herbs.
  6. Season with salt and pepper and mix well.
  7. Take a portion of the meat mixture (as big as a grapefruit) stuff it with one cooked and peeled egg, prune, barberries,
  8. Walnuts and fried onion.
  9. Wrap and make a meat ball shape.
  10. Bring to boil, 1000 ml water
  11. And gently slip the stuffed kofteh one by one and potatoes.
  12. Add prepared sauce as well. Let it simmer for 45 minutes.
  13. Once kofteh is ready, transfer it to a platter and serve it with fresh herbs, salad or pickled vegetables (torshi).
